Transaction 4b3af262a2865883694ed9497ac2c3130c7e59bbe28ef15e6482677b49b1a61b
1 Input
1 Output
-
4b3af262a2865883694ed9497ac2c3130c7e59bbe28ef15e6482677b49b1a61b:0
- value
- 76977587
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 cc9648c58cce1d3cf2c1faaa1c258475ec3baa27 OP_EQUAL
- address
- 3LLmocPM3d3Gjm1fTAH2j8ZDJ3NXx8SEMd